How is Jade supposed to focus on herself right now? \u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e But at the Art Farm, Jade has artistic opportunities she's been waiting for her whole life. And as she gets to know her classmates, she begins to fall for whimsical, upbeat, comfortable-in-her-own-skin Mary. Jade pours herself into making ceramic monsters that vent her stress and insecurities, but when she puts her creatures in the kiln, something unreal happens: they come to life.
